Pros & Cons
Moto Edge 30 Pro
Pros
- 144Hz P-OLED display is buttery smooth
- 68W fast charging
- 60 MP selfie camera is excellent
- 50 MP ultrawide is high quality
- Near-stock Android experience
Cons
- 2 MP depth camera is useless
- IP52 rating is only splash-proof
- No telephoto camera
-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 overheating
- Slow software update schedule
vivo X300 FE
Pros
- Exceptional camera system with 3x telephoto and strong low-light performance
- Industry-leading 4500 nits display brightness for excellent outdoor visibility
- Fast 80W wireless charging and 80W wired charging
- Robust IP69 water and dust resistance
- Flagship Snapdragon 8 Elite processor with 16GB RAM
- Large 6000mAh battery for extended usage
Cons
- Premium pricing likely exceeds $1200
- Heavy at 220g may feel cumbersome for extended use
- No microSD card expansion typical of flagship phones
- Limited availability outside select markets
- FE variant specs not fully detailed in launch materials
